Who: Hospice Lottery Partnership
Position: Business Development Assistant
Salary: £30,000
Location: Office (Tring, Herts)/hybrid working after first month. 1-2 days at home will be considered
Hours: 37.5 Monday to Friday
Are you looking to start a varied and rewarding career in business development? We are excited to invite enthusiastic and motivated applicants to join us as our new Business Development Assistant.
This is an ideal role for someone who is keen to learn, enjoys working with people and wants to develop their career in areas such as account management, business development or marketing. With a mix of office work, community engagement and partner interaction, you will play an important part in helping us grow our reach and impact.
Role responsibilities to include:
* Support relationships with local businesses through follow-up calls, emails and enquiries.
* Keep contact records accurate and updated in line with HLP procedures.
* Assist with preparing information packs, meeting notes and updates for partners.
* Research local venues and events suitable for canvassing.
* Update the venue diary and confirm bookings with venues.
* Support the scheduling of canvasser activity and ensure information is shared clearly.
* Keep sales trackers and spreadsheets up to date, checking accuracy.
* Help prepare sales materials and organise canvasser resources such as ID badges, uniforms and point-of-sale items.
* Support marketing tasks including preparing posters, leaflets and distributing materials.
* Assist communication with partner charities by preparing updates, sharing information and arranging meetings.
Essential person specification to include:
* Experience in sales, business development, or marketing, preferably in community or charity-focused initiatives.
* Strong organisational and project management skills with attention to detail.
* Excellent communication and relationship-building abilities.
*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ment.
* Proficiency in data analysis and performance tracking to inform strategic decisions.
